What is Shipping Container Architecture?
Shipping container architecture involves the design and construction of structures utilizing intermodal containers as the main building product. These steel boxes, originally intended for transferring goods across oceans, are lauded for their strength, sturdiness, and modularity. The pattern has developed into a robust movement in sustainable structure practices, interesting eco-conscious designers, home builders, and property owners alike.

Sustainability: One of the most significant benefits of shipping container architecture is its eco-friendliness. By repurposing these containers, builders contribute to product reuse and lower waste. In addition, their sturdiness extends the life process of the raw products, decreasing the demand for new resources.

Cost-Effectiveness: Shipping containers are generally less costly than standard structure products. Their accessibility in the pre-owned market likewise adds to decrease costs, making them an appealing alternative for budget-sensitive jobs.

Speed of Construction: Shipping container structures can be constructed fairly quickly, as many of the elements are pre-fabricated. This speed enables quicker tenancy, which is essential in housing crises or for momentary setups.

Design Flexibility: Shipping containers can be combined, stacked, and modified extensively, providing designers with ample opportunities to create unique designs that cater to specific requirements and aesthetics.

Mobility: Shipping container structures can be transferred quickly, making them perfect for momentary structures or mobile living solutions.
Challenges of Shipping Container Architecture
While the advantages of shipping container architecture are huge, it is necessary to think about the potential difficulties as well.

Insulation: The metal structure of Shipping Container Rental containers poses difficulties relating to temperature level policy. Appropriate insulation is required to make sure convenience in both hot and cold environments.

Zoning Laws and Regulations: Depending on local regulations, acquiring consent to construct a shipping container home can be complicated. Each municipality has various structure codes that might not acknowledge shipping containers as appropriate structure materials.

Modifications: While containers are structurally strong, modifications such as cutting and welding can deteriorate their stability. Proper engineering is needed to guarantee security and durability.

Rust and Corrosion: Shipping Container Office containers are designed for maritime use, but prolonged direct exposure to wetness can result in rust. Treatments and finishings are often necessary to fight this issue.

Creating with Shipping Containers
The design procedure for a shipping container task normally includes the following actions:

Concept Development: Define the function and overall vision for the container structure.

Website Assessment: Evaluate the site for zoning constraints, gain access to, and utility connections.

Container Sourcing: Identify and procure the needed shipping containers based upon size, condition, and spending plan.

Architectural Planning: Collaborate with designers or design experts to create comprehensive plans, designs, and structural engineering evaluations.

Construction: Engage construction specialists with experience in working with shipping containers, ensuring that all modifications comply with security standards.

Completing Touches: Install energies, insulation, interior finishes, and landscaping to finish the job.
